U.S. Military Strike
- The U.S. military conducted a strike on November 6, killing three alleged drug traffickers in the Caribbean.
-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th claimed the vessel was linked to a designated terrorist organization, but offered no evidence.
- This operation marked the 17th strike since September, raising the death toll to at least 70.
- Venezuelan President Nicolás Maduro accused the United States of fabricating a conflict.
- U.S. President Donald Trump signaled land strikes.
